estmcture our The Lurie Bell Tower stands in the center of the North Campus Diag. It was part of major con- struction on north cam- pus including the addi- tion of a reflecting pool in front of the Lurie En- gineering Building. ' eter Nielsen We commemorated beginnings, from the newly con- structed Diag to a new athletic director. On the morning that the Wolverine ' s clenched the Big Ten Championship, the University broke ground for construction of additional seat- ing at the Big House. Other developments shook the founda- tions of some of our dearest institutions, including an affirmative action lawsuit against the University ' s admis- sions policy and the firing of a popular basketball coach. First year students began the best four (or five) years of their lives, while seniors struggled to say good-bye to the place they now referred to as home. Opening 5
